Political Memory: Alexandra DOBOLYI, MEP
General Data
- Born on 26 September 1971, Budapest
- Country: Hungary
- Political Group: Socialist Group in the European Parliament (PSE)
Party: Magyar Szocialista Párt

Curriculum Vitae
- Studied Human Relations, Janus Pannonius University (1994/95-1999/2000)
- PhD, University of Pécs and Eötvös Loránd University (2000- )
- Ministry of Foreign Affairs, official responsible for EU affairs (1998)
- Hungarian Parliament - Socialist Party (MSZP) Working Group on Foreign Affairs (1998)
- Secretary for Foreign Affairs, MSZP (2002-2004)
- Member, Ethics Committee, Socialist International (2003)
- Chair, Committee for the CIS countries, Socialist International (2005)
- Member of the Presidency of the PES - Party of European Socialists.MSZP Foreign Policy Director (2007)
